What are some of the best neighborhoods to live in Hoffman Estates? +
Some of the best neighborhoods to live in Hoffman Estates include The Highlands, which is a peaceful and family-friendly area known for its safety and quiet ambiance. Other desirable areas tend to be in the north parts of the city, while more affordable homes are in the southwest regions.
What are some fun things to do in Hoffman Estates? +
There are plenty of fun things to do in Hoffman Estates, such as visiting the Now Arena, The Stonegate Conference and Banquet Centre, and Seascape Family Aquatic Center. You can also check out the Underground Retrocade, Cirque du Soleil, and Level 257, an adult Pacman-based arcade at Woodfield Mall.
What is the food scene like in Hoffman Estates? +
The food scene in Hoffman Estates is diverse and exciting, with a range of restaurants to choose from, including Nostimo, Lucky Monk, Phoenix Flame, and Crazy Crab. You can also find great Italian sandwiches at Franco's Cucina, and ramen at Mitsuwa and Kitakata.
